October 9, 2021
by Dustin Semore, Sports Information Director
MOUNT PLEASANT, Iowa – Crowley's Ridge bounced back from a pair of Friday defeats in the Continental Athletic Conference Classic by besting the hosting Iowa Wesleyan Tigers 3-1 (20-25, 25-22, 25-22, 25-22) before falling in the final matchup of the weekend 3-1 to Lincoln Christian (Ill.) University (25-21, 15-25, 19-25, 20-25).
Match One
Crowley's Ridge - 3
Iowa Wesleyan - 1
The Lady Pioneers (6-9, 1-3 CAC) were slow to get started, falling behind 2-9 before and Olivia Deckelman anchored rally pulled CRC within three points. A late push by CRC kept the set close, but the Lady Pioneers fell in the opener 25-20.
Crowley's Ridge had the most stifling defense in the second set, holding IWU (1-19, 0-4 CAC) to eight kills while boasting 15 kills of their own. The final three sets had identical score marks with the Lady 'Neers besting the Tigers 25-22 to win the match.
Hannah Halverson posted a double-double in the first match of the day with 10 kills and 18 digs. Emi Elms led the CRC attack with 12 kills while adding three solo blocks.
Match Two
Lincoln Christian - 3
Crowley's Ridge - 1
Despite winning the opening set, the final match of the weekend was less kind to Crowley's Ridge (6-10, 1-4 CAC) who lost the final three sets in a mirror image of the day's first match.
Jadyn Hesse began the festivities with a bang, boasting two of her match's five service aces in the first six rallies of the set. Despite the Red Lions (5-16, 3-0 CAC) having more kills in the first set, Crowley's Ridge fought back to win the set 25-21.
The Lady Pioneers would stumble in the second set, reaching a total of 15 points before falling in the final two sets to allow Lincoln Christian to end CRC's weekend with a 3-1 loss.
Hannah Halverson ended her afternoon with nine kills and 12 digs, while Hesse totaled five service aces.
